DNA and protein molecular weight markers are laboratory tools used to determine the size and molecular weight of DNA and protein molecules. They serve as a reference to estimate the size or molecular weight of unknown samples when analyzed using techniques such as gel electrophoresis.

Molecular Cloning Reagents Sourcing

High-purity-grade reagents from Merck (Munich, Germany), Sigma (OOO Sigma-Aldrich Rus, Moscow, Russia), and Helicon (Moscow, Russia) were used. Kits for DNA extraction, restriction, and ligation, oligonucleotides, and Taq polymerase were purchased from Evrogen (Moscow, Russia) and Thermo Fisher Scientific RU (Moscow, Khimki, Russia); kanamycin was produced by Sintez (Moscow, Russia). Yeast extract, bactoagar, tryptone, and peptone were purchased from “Helicon” and “Dia-M” (Moscow, Russia). DNA and protein molecular weight markers were purchased from BioRad (Hercules, CA, USA).
